循环创建DataFrame可以通过以下步骤实现:
import pandas as pd
df = pd.DataFrame(columns=['列名1', '列名2', ...])
append()
方法将其添加到DataFrame中。以下是一个示例代码:for i in range(10):
data = {'列名1': 值1, '列名2': 值2, ...}
df = df.append(data, ignore_index=True)
在上述代码中,range(10)
表示循环10次,可以根据需要进行调整。值1
、值2
等表示每一行对应列的值,可以根据实际情况进行替换。
print()
函数或df.head()
方法查看DataFrame的内容。以下是一个示例代码:print(df)
或
print(df.head())
这样就完成了使用循环创建DataFrame的过程。
需要注意的是,循环创建DataFrame可能会导致性能问题,特别是在数据量较大的情况下。如果可能的话,建议使用其他更高效的方法来创建DataFrame,例如使用列表推导式或使用pd.DataFrame.from_records()
方法。
关于DataFrame的更多信息和操作,请参考腾讯云的相关文档和教程:
云+社区沙龙online [技术应变力]
企业创新在线学堂
企业创新在线学堂
云+社区沙龙online
北极星训练营
北极星训练营
高校公开课
北极星训练营
腾讯云GAME-TECH沙龙
领取专属 10元无门槛券
手把手带您无忧上云